我想确保以正确的顺序按下某些按钮,我该怎么做?

Posted

技术标签:

【中文标题】我想确保以正确的顺序按下某些按钮,我该怎么做?【英文标题】:I want to make sure that some buttons are pressed in the correct order, how do I do this? 【发布时间】:2017-03-20 16:28:42 【问题描述】:

嘿,我只是想使用 pyqt 创建一个基本的逻辑游戏,它需要以正确的顺序按下一些按钮才能打开“安全”,我怎么能在使用数组时做到这一点?我对这些东西很了解,如果很简单,我很抱歉!

【问题讨论】:

您能解释一下您目前所做的工作并提供相关代码吗? 【参考方案1】:

每次有人按下按钮时,将他们按下的按钮添加到数组中(“1”如果他们按下第一个按钮,“2”如果他们按下第二个按钮),一旦这个数组的大小等于代码中有很多数字,请检查数组中的所有数字是否与代码中的所有数字匹配。

【讨论】:

抱歉,我想也许问如何创建一个数组会更好地表达我的问题? ArrayName=[] 创建一个空白数组。 ArrayName.append(value)value 添加到 ArrayName

以上是关于我想确保以正确的顺序按下某些按钮,我该怎么做?的主要内容,如果未能解决你的问题,请参考以下文章

以随机顺序重新排列NSArray / MSMutableArray

如何显示随机视图?

对于每个不按正确顺序开火

如何以正确的顺序获取分段掩码中的通道?

按字母顺序排列的名称和描述列表

如何确保休眠 5 在与共享主键的一对一关系中保持正确的顺序